About the Innovation Hub

Founded in 2016, the Tom Love Innovation Hub, also known as the I-Hub, originated as a cutting-edge facility to foster the creation, development and implementation of innovative ideas. Today, the Innovation Hub and its partner programs have established the University of Oklahoma as a leader in the Oklahoma entrepreneurial ecosystem.

Purpose

Purposed with advancing innovation and entrepreneurship at the University of Oklahoma and across our state, the Innovation Hub has helped to launch many new ventures and entrepreneurial projects. Its programs have rapidly grown the entrepreneurial ecosystem in Oklahoma by providing top-tier talent and launching promising businesses into the economy.

Funding

Innovation Hub programs are made possible by grants and other funding from the Price College of Business, the U.S. Economic Development Administration (EDA) University Center, the Small Business Administration (SBA), SBA Growth Accelerator, the Federal and State (FAST) Partner Program, the state of Oklahoma, and private donors.
